网络原理
2022-02-15 16:34:44 0 举报
网络原理数据传输图
作者其他创作
大纲/内容
PSH
HTTPS
数据链路层
LISTEN(listen())
128.0.0.0——191.255.255.255
ESTABLISHED
断开连接四次握手
TCP的三次握手与四次挥手
IP地址范围
SNMP
seq=x+1 ACK=y+1
链路层
TCP/IP参考模型
协 议
URG
TCP首部
端口
23
SYN_RCVD
传输层
保 留
0——127
CLOSED
端口号
IP 数 据 报
ACK x+2
物理层
SMTP
443
会话层
应用层
用户数据
五层协议
CLOSE_WAIT
目的端口
24bit
IP地址类别
网络范围
生 存 时 间
以太网首部
建立三次握手
69
Appl首部
SYN_SENT(connect())
16bit 前二位固定为 10
片 偏 移
应用数据
运输层
(write())
运输层(TCP或UDP)
16bit
1.0.0.0——127.255.255.255
8bit
选 项 (长 度 可 变)
标 志
填 充
IP首部
25
TCP 首 部
确认号
版 本
以太网尾部
HTTP
检 验 和
可 选 字 段 (长 度 可 变)
192.0.0——223.255.255
FIN
TCP 段
网络层
21
数 据 部 分
ACK=y+2
Client
数据传输
表示层
128.0——191.255
序 号
FIN_WAIT_1(close())
IP 地址分类
目 的 地 址
应用程序
网络层IP
DNS
SYN seq=y,ACK=x+1
首 部 长 度
固定部分
TELNET
TCP 报文
首部
53
数 据偏 移
解封装
ACK=y+1
紧 急 指 针
总 长 度
A类
C类
源 地 址
ACK
IP数据报
OSI参考模型
FIN seq=x+2ACK=y+1
比特流
(read())
TIME_WAIT
80
TCP 数 据 部 分
192.0.0.0——223.255.255.255
网 络 号
161
首 部 检 验 和
源 端 口
主机号
服 务 类 型
封装
网安1901201931224021秦庆龙
24bit 前三位固定为 110
Server
FTP
FIN seq=y+1
网络接口层
8bit 第一位固定为 0
SYN
TFTP
SYN seq=x
可变部分
B类
RST
FIN_WAIT_2
ACK x+3
首 部
标 识
以太网帧
窗 口
LAST_WAIT(close())
0 条评论
下一页